An Overview of Metal Finishing - Usually, the polishing of metal is desirable for appearance or for clean-room usages. It really is one of the more recognized methods because of its utility in maximizing the overall beauty of the items, such as, motorcycle parts, kitchenware or auto parts. What's more, a great many clean-rooms would need a polished finish to decrease the porosity of the material that will result in debris to build up and contaminate. A really good instance of this usage could be in vacuum chambers.

There are certainly countless different ways to polish metals, and let's take a peek at examples of the steps required. Metals may be finished by hand, with purpose made bu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A buffing paste or compound is normally utilized, which may include chalk, chromium oxide, lim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Polishing stainless steel, because of its inferior th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its fairly high viscidness is among the most time-consuming. On the other hand, merchandise created from non-ferrous metal are more receptive to buffing, simply because these need the least amount of operations.

Polishing buffs smothered in paste are seriously impacted by the force on the surface of the pad. The level of the surface pressure may be increased within certain boundaries, however using more than the most effective degree of pressure not just lowers the quality of the process, but additionally can degrade effectiveness, could result in wear on the part, plus there is also an apparent heating up of the work-pieces, brought about by friction. When polishing thin metal, it's greater temperature (and the relating flexibility of the material) which can cause parts to warp, distort, or bend. In general, it will take a qualified polisher to factor in each one of these elements to equally prevent harm to the piece and to work adequately. To help significantly increase the quality of the completed surface area, the buffing operation needs to be performed with reduced aggression and not a large amount of force in order to in the end deliver a surface devoid of scratches or marks as a consequence of the polishing process, therefore ending up with a fabulous mirror finish.
